Transaction c599902514a163b4620a4b4fb135510020ecc7918f91bbdeedc398bd23967875

1 Input
2 Outputs
  • c599902514a163b4620a4b4fb135510020ecc7918f91bbdeedc398bd23967875:0
  • value  895942
    address  1MaJGsaLBC6UGAWEWQFYQsnbr23PPb35Gs
  • c599902514a163b4620a4b4fb135510020ecc7918f91bbdeedc398bd23967875:1
  • value  1493750
    address  17dcxFDc49DZLYpKZAfdJEMMmgXvdEETYi